In the past 2 days, Samsung accidentally let slip that it was coming to VZW in a tweet. So, VZW caught wind, chides them for announcing that before the VZW announcement. Samsung retracts their comment, replaces it, denying that any carrier is already set to receive it here in the US. Tech. sights report that VZW may not get it, geekdom panics. Less than 24 hrs. later, VZW issues the first "official" press release. Will Verizon ever not shoot themselves in the foot, at least once, in their PR campaigns for the big upcoming releases. imho I don't think Verizon said "No" to the Nexus One.  Google was the one that miffed.  They stated that they were going to bring it to all carriers.  The Nexus One only roughly sold compared to the Droid or some of the older phones for that matter.  People were complaining about the fact the devices were subsidized TWICE and Google had their own Terms of Sale like any 3rd party retailer.  They opted in not to make the CDMA version, and recommended people get something else.  It wasn't selling well enough and honestly there wasn't a real big demand for it.
